Abstract
Disclosed is a method of altering the zirconium 91 isotopic content of zirconium by raising a zirconium chelate ligand from a ground state to an activated state in the presence of a scavenger which reacts with the activated state but not with the ground state, and permitting about 25 to about 75% of the zirconium chelate to react with the scavenger. The reaction may be performed in a solution of the zirconium chelate ligand using water as a solvent. Activation of the zirconium chelate may be accomplished by using light and having a wavelength of about 220 to about 350 nm or by heating to about 80 to about 100.degree. C.
